应用如何上架苹果
苹果的应用商店是苹果公司为iOS设备提供的官方应用下载平台,对于开发者来说,将自己的应用上架到苹果商店,是一件十分重要的事情。本文将介绍应用如何上架苹果的原理和步骤。1. 注册苹果开发者账号首先,开发者需要在苹果开发者网站上注册一个开发者账号。注册完成后,需要支付一定的年费,才能够获得上架应用的资格...
2023-12-16 围观 : 1次
苹果证书是用于iOS开发中的一种重要工具,可以让开发者将自己的应用程序上传到苹果的App Store上架。本文将介绍苹果证书的生成和上架的详细过程。
一、证书生成
在生成证书之前,需要先在苹果开发者中心注册一个账户,然后创建一个App ID,这个App ID是用来标示你的应用程序的唯一标识符。
1. 创建CSR
CSR(Certificate Signing Request)是一种证书签名请求,用于向证书颁发机构(CA)申请证书。
在生成证书之前,需要先生成一个CSR文件。打开Keychain Access,选择“Keychain Access” - “Certificate Assistant” - “Request a Certificate from a Certificate Authority”来创建一个CSR文件。
2. 创建证书
在生成CSR文件之后,需要在苹果开发者中心创建一个证书。选择“Certificates, Identifiers & Profiles” - “Certificates” - “+” - “iOS App Development”来创建一个证书。
在创建证书的过程中,需要将之前生成的CSR文件上传到苹果开发者中心,并且需要将App ID与证书关联起来。
3. 下载证书
在创建证书之后,需要在本地下载证书。选择“Certificates, Identifiers & Profiles” - “Certificates” - “Download”来下载证书。
将下载的证书文件双击打开,将证书安装到Keychain Access中。
二、应用程序上架
在生成证书之后,就可以将应用程序上传到苹果的App Store上架了。
1. 编译应用程序
首先需要将应用程序编译成IPA文件。在Xcode中选择“Product” - “Archive”来生成IPA文件。
2. 创建App Store列表
在上传应用程序之前,需要在iTunes Connect中创建一个App Store列表。选择“My Apps” - “+” - “New App”来创建一个新的App。
在创建App Store列表的过程中,需要填写应用程序的相关信息,包括应用程序名称、描述、价格等等。
3. 上传应用程序
在创建App Store列表之后,就可以上传应用程序了。选择“Xcode” - “Open Developer Tool” - “Application Loader”来上传应用程序。
在上传应用程序之前,需要先选择要上传的证书,然后选择要上传的IPA文件。上传完成后,应用程序就可以在苹果的App Store上架了。
总结
苹果证书的生成和上架过程比较繁琐,但是只要按照上述步骤操作,就可以顺利地完成证书的生成和应用程序的上架。同时,需要注意证书的有效期,及时更新证书,以免影响应用程序的正常上架和使用。
苹果的应用商店是苹果公司为iOS设备提供的官方应用下载平台,对于开发者来说,将自己的应用上架到苹果商店,是一件十分重要的事情。本文将介绍应用如何上架苹果的原理和步骤。1. 注册苹果开发者账号首先,开发者需要在苹果开发者网站上注册一个开发者账号。注册完成后,需要支付一定的年费,才能够获得上架应用的资格...
近年来,随着移动互联网的快速发展,直播行业也迅速崛起。直播成为了一种新兴的社交娱乐方式,吸引了越来越多的用户。苹果作为一家全球知名的科技公司,也积极跟随这一趋势,推出了小平台直播app,为用户提供了更加便捷、高效的直播服务。小平台直播app的原理主要是通过网络连接将用户的视频、音频等数据传输到服务器...
在安卓应用市场上架一款应用程序需要支付一定的费用,这笔费用主要是由应用市场平台收取的。下面将详细介绍安卓软件上架费用的原理和具体情况。一、应用市场平台收费原理应用市场平台为开发者提供了应用程序发布和推广的平台,同时也为用户提供了下载和使用应用程序的渠道。在这个过程中,应用市场平台会收取一定的费用,以...
苹果正规上架是指将开发者开发的应用程序提交到苹果公司的App Store进行审核,并在审核通过后在App Store上架销售。这是苹果公司对应用程序进行管理和监管的重要措施,可以保证用户的使用体验和应用程序的安全性。苹果正规上架的原理主要分为以下几个步骤:1.开发应用程序开发者需要使用苹果公司提供的...
MUI(Mobile UI)是一款基于HTML5和CSS3的移动端UI框架,它提供了一系列的UI组件和丰富的样式,可以帮助开发者快速构建出漂亮、流畅、易用的移动应用。MUI的成功上架App Store,离不开以下几个方面的原因:一、MUI的设计理念MUI的设计理念是“Mobile Web App”,...